The Malawi Revenue Authority (MRA) is an agency of the Government of Malawi responsible for assessment, collection, and accounting for tax revenues in Malawi. Based in Malawi, the MRA plays a crucial role in the country’s economic development by collecting taxes and ensuring compliance with tax laws. With its headquarters likely in Lilongwe or Blantyre, the MRA operates across Malawi, serving taxpayers and contributing to the country’s revenue. The MRA’s core function is to generate revenue for the Malawi government, which is used to fund public services and infrastructure development. By carrying out its mandate, the MRA helps to promote economic growth and stability in Malawi.
